How the LKP works

lxuwfs

This virtual filesystem provides a means of viewing files and directories that would otherwise be difficult or impossible to access from within the LKP.

lxuwfs provides several mount points. /linux/unixware supplies a way back to the UnixWare 7 root directory and enables access to UnixWare 7 files from Linux mode. lxuwfs also enables /tmp and /home to be shared between UnixWare 7 and Linux environments.
